The thing is that the locations appearing in the search dropdowns are suggested by Google Places API and can’t be controlled on our end.

When you select a suggested result, the widget sends that address/ZIP to our service, which converts it to coordinates. Then the widget takes your locations and sorts them by distance to those coordinates.

Thus, the list of the suggested locations isn’t generated on by Google Places API, this is why it’s impossible to restrict the search results to the locations added to the widgets.
